Mark Schmidt, 29, died Sunday, June 25, 2006, at Rathdrum, Idaho, following a year of battling cancer.

He was born April 27, 1977, in Milwaukee, Wis., and grew up in Oak Creek, Wis. He moved to Libby in 2000 after he married Amber Johnson-Schmidt of Libby to be close to her family. He worked as a plumbing estimator for a local Couer d'Alene business, 3H Mechanical.

In June of 2005 at age 28, he was diagnosed with stage 5 colorectal cancer. He was unable to walk or eat the last couple months of his life. Days before his death his best friend's daughter, Brynn, asked him if he would be at her birthday party in August? He simply said '"I don't think so but I will definitely be walking by then.."

He was an extremely devoted husband and father. He loved his wife and children more than life itself. He is survived by his wife, Amber, who slept on the floor by his bedside during the past year, and his four beautiful children: Ty, 12; Casey, 5; Jack, 4, and Lucy Moon, 2.

He is also survived by his parents Barb and Ellis Schmidt of Webeno, Wis. In-laws Sandra and Guy Hankins of Spokane, Wash., and Tony and Cindy Johnson of Libby, younger brother's Dean and Scot, his extended family and too many friends to list.
